Output ceb33beffb150c9e88c921200509291035e360ea04158d06588327759d1b0fcf:1

value
20958000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37075c5f0752795a92a1a57c2a201b5679b8998b OP_EQUAL
address
MCv8DRJxtJ6DBUps3yFscHUtrNC8qW8PZ6
transaction
ceb33beffb150c9e88c921200509291035e360ea04158d06588327759d1b0fcf
spent
true